    David Coverdale (lead vocals) is one of those voices in rock who is instantly recognizable... Coverdale replaced singer Ian Gillan in Deep Purple in 1974 - no easy task... and kept the band's popularity... but after Purple split in 1976, Coverdale went solo. He formed Whitesnake in the late 70's and became the most successful ex-member of Deep Purple. In 1993, he recorded the successful Coverdale.Page album w/ Led Zeppelin's guitarist Jimmy Page... Recently, David Coverdale announced plans to retire (he'll be 71 this year) after a final tour w/ Whitesnake.

    Great, great song from their 1987 album that still rocks today! I know you were impressed by the guitar player Reb Beach. But let's give some props to the drummer, Tommy Aldridge! He's just a thunderous octopus on those drums! He started playing with WS on the 1987 album tour and then was on the next album, Slip Of The Tongue and that tour. When Coverdale got WS back together in the 2000's for touring, Tommy came back and didn't miss a beat! And yes, Coverdale is known for that mic stand move. He's been doing that since the 1970's when he was in Deep Purple. He even has his mic stands custom made so he can do it (from what I remember reading).
